Which chemical is primarily used in permanent hair color?

  1. Hydrogen peroxide

  2. Ammonia

  3. Bleach

  4. Alcohol

The correct answer is: Ammonia

Ammonia is primarily used in permanent hair color because it serves a critical role in the hair coloring process. It opens the hair cuticle, allowing the color molecules to penetrate the hair shaft effectively. This penetration is essential for the color to become permanent, as it ensures that the dye can blend with the natural pigment in the hair. Ammonia's basic pH facilitates this process, making it an essential component in many permanent hair dyes. Hydrogen peroxide, while important in hair color formulations, functions primarily as an oxidizing agent, helping to lighten the hair and also acting to develop the color after the dye has penetrated. Bleach serves a different purpose, typically used to lighten hair significantly rather than deposit color. Alcohol, used in some hair products for its solvent properties, is not integral to the chemical process involved in permanent hair coloring.
